
COVID-19: Morris County drive-thru test site to resume Monday — adverse weather could impact schedule
UPDATE: As a result of the anticipated weather for Monday April 13, 2020, the Morris County Drive Thru Testing Site located at the County College of Morris will be closed. Anyone that had an appointment for Monday can reschedule for Tuesday, April 14. The staff is in the process of calling all of those scheduled for Monday to assist with the rescheduling process.
RANDOLPH TOWNSHIP, NJ (Morris County) – The Morris County COVID-19 drive-thru testing center is expected to resume operating on Monday morning at the County College of Morris in Randolph Township. However, current weather forecasts that portend rain and strong winds on Monday could postpone that testing.
The County Office of Emergency Management is advising those who have made Monday appointments to monitor the Morris County Government, Office of Health Management and OEM websites and social media sites for any postponement.
If there is a weather issue, the county will reach out to residents with appointments by phone and email contacts that residents have provided.

To be tested, you must be in a Morris County resident, must be in a vehicle, must have identification, must have an appointment and must have a prescription from a medical provider.
The Morris County COVID-19 drive-thru testing site is located at CCM, Center Grove Road, Randolph, NJ 07869. Residents with appointments must use the Center Grove Road entrance to access the site.
